/* SPDX-License-Identifier: BSD-3-Clause
* Copyright (c) 2023 Nokia
*/
/**
* @file
*
* ODP event validation
*
* @warning These definitions are not part of ODP API, they are for
* implementation internal use only.
*/
#ifndef ODP_EVENT_VALIDATION_EXTERNAL_H_
#define ODP_EVENT_VALIDATION_EXTERNAL_H_
#include <odp/autoheader_external.h>
#include <odp/api/buffer_types.h>
#include <odp/api/event_types.h>
#include <odp/api/hints.h>
#include <odp/api/packet_types.h>
/** @cond _ODP_HIDE_FROM_DOXYGEN_ */
#ifdef __cplusplus
extern "C" {
#endif
/** Enumerations for identifying ODP API functions */
typedef enum {
_ODP_EV_BUFFER_FREE = 0,
_ODP_EV_BUFFER_FREE_MULTI,
_ODP_EV_BUFFER_IS_VALID,
_ODP_EV_EVENT_FREE,
_ODP_EV_EVENT_FREE_MULTI,
_ODP_EV_EVENT_FREE_SP,
_ODP_EV_EVENT_IS_VALID,
_ODP_EV_PACKET_FREE,
_ODP_EV_PACKET_FREE_MULTI,
_ODP_EV_PACKET_FREE_SP,
_ODP_EV_PACKET_IS_VALID,
_ODP_EV_QUEUE_ENQ,
_ODP_EV_QUEUE_ENQ_MULTI,
_ODP_EV_MAX
} _odp_ev_id_t;
/* Implementation internal event validation functions */
#if _ODP_EVENT_VALIDATION
int _odp_event_validate(odp_event_t event, _odp_ev_id_t id);
int _odp_event_validate_multi(const odp_event_t event[], int num, _odp_ev_id_t id);
int _odp_buffer_validate(odp_buffer_t buf, _odp_ev_id_t ev_id);
int _odp_buffer_validate_multi(const odp_buffer_t buf[], int num, _odp_ev_id_t ev_id);
int _odp_packet_validate(odp_packet_t pkt, _odp_ev_id_t ev_id);
int _odp_packet_validate_multi(const odp_packet_t pkt[], int num, _odp_ev_id_t ev_id);
#else
static inline int _odp_event_validate(odp_event_t event ODP_UNUSED, _odp_ev_id_t ev_id ODP_UNUSED)
{
return 0;
}
static inline int _odp_event_validate_multi(const odp_event_t event[] ODP_UNUSED,
int num ODP_UNUSED,
_odp_ev_id_t ev_id ODP_UNUSED)
{
return 0;
}
static inline int _odp_buffer_validate(odp_buffer_t buf ODP_UNUSED, _odp_ev_id_t ev_id ODP_UNUSED)
{
return 0;
}
static inline int _odp_buffer_validate_multi(const odp_buffer_t buf[] ODP_UNUSED,
int num ODP_UNUSED,
_odp_ev_id_t ev_id ODP_UNUSED)
{
return 0;
}
static inline int _odp_packet_validate(odp_packet_t pkt ODP_UNUSED, _odp_ev_id_t ev_id ODP_UNUSED)
{
return 0;
}
static inline int _odp_packet_validate_multi(const odp_packet_t pkt[] ODP_UNUSED,
int num ODP_UNUSED,
_odp_ev_id_t ev_id ODP_UNUSED)
{
return 0;
}
#endif /* _ODP_EVENT_VALIDATION */
#ifdef __cplusplus
}
#endif
/** @endcond */
#endif
